Mark Bishop - Can I Pray for You?

image

Producer: Jeff Collins/Mark Bishop
  Label: Sonlite Records

I think Mark Bishop has hit his stride with this recording. Mark has the uncanny ability to stir our hearts with his songs and he has the vocals by which to sing those songs with such feeling and emotion. I didn’t think Mark could beat his first recording “Faith, Family & Friends”, but he surpassed it with this newest release, “Can I Pray For You?” .

Mark can weave a story like few songwriters can and the extraordinary story about faith and salvation in “OCTOBER HARVEST” warms the heart and sets the tone for the whole recording. If you’re like me and highly enjoy his story songs, then this recording will not disappoint. “I GOT HERE AS FAST AS I COULD” and “LET ME TELL WHAT HE DID FOR ME” are but two examples of Mark’s storytelling prowess.

The highly energetic “ANGELS SWING A LITTLE LOWER” is a song you’ll be hitting the repeat button with quite a bit as well as “TURN LOOSE FOR NOTHIN’” (which offers some good, sound advice) and “WE NEED JESUS”.

I honestly feel “CAN I PRAY FOR YOU?” will be Mark’s first #1 song. This is such a tender song and typical of Mark’s writings. In contrast, showing off Mark’s soulful side is the song “FILLED AND FULFILLED”, while “SHOW US LOVE-PART I” portrays an intriguing story and one that many of us can or at least one day, will probably relate to.

“JESUS IS A QUIET PLACE FOR ME ” is a fascinating song musically, as the verses and chorus feature different time signatures, but lyrically, is one we all should be able to share. Mark closes the recording with “SHOW US LOVE-PART II” which brings Part I to a more personal level and a different point of view.

I have always been a fan of Mark’s writings, and appreciate the values and thoughts he tries to convey through his songs. He is a remarkable writer and an excellent vocalist. With a style vocally similar to James Taylor, one can find Mark’s laid-back approach very easy to listen to. “Can I Pray For You?” is one of the finest releases for 2004. Going out on a limb, I will dare say that this could be the recording by which all other Mark Bishop recordings are measured!  

Personal Favs: OCTOBER HARVEST; ANGELS SWING A LITTLE LOWER; CAN I PRAY FOR YOU?; I GOT HERE AS FAST AS I COULD; SHOW US LOVE
